For air conditioning units requiring year-round cooling, a condensing pressure controller is added to the refrigeration and control systems. This controller continuously monitors system characteristics and controls the start and stop of the condensing fan, ensuring the refrigeration system operates within a reasonable range and guaranteeing reliable operation at low temperatures. Additionally, outdoor fresh air can be introduced for energy-saving cooling during low-temperature periods.
The Air Cooled Air Conditioner can achieve year-round cooling operation within an ultra-wide ambient temperature range (-15℃ to 65℃), better meeting the needs of various electrical control rooms.
Unit-type air-cooled cabinet air conditioners are divided into four main categories: direct air supply, top air supply with front return air, top air supply with rear return air, and jet air outlet. To meet the needs of different working environments or usage locations, the units are further divided into heat pump type, heat pump with electric auxiliary heating type, cold air with electric heating type, cold air and hot water coil type, 100% fresh air type, and single-cooling type units for users to choose from. With a wide variety of models and a broad cooling capacity range, they can meet the air conditioning needs of various commercial spaces and special industrial applications.
Standard compressor configurations feature Daikin and Panasonic scroll units, with optional Emerson Copeland models available, ensuring the reliability and performance of core components.
The evaporator employs internally threaded copper tubing wrapped in hydrophilic-coated aluminium fins, with louvered fin profiles enhancing the heat transfer coefficient to improve refrigeration efficiency.
Water-cooled condensers are available in two configurations: flooded high-efficiency tanks and dry shell-and-tube units, offering customers diverse options.
The computer board employs Huzhou Defu industrial-grade MCUs, featuring built-in phase sequence, phase loss, high/low voltage, exhaust temperature, and sensor fault detection. An optional RS485 interface supports the Modbus-RTU protocol.
Electrical components are standard-fitted with LS Electric contactors and thermal relays, with optional ABB or Schneider alternatives, ensuring the safety and reliability of the electrical system.
High and low-pressure switches utilise Changzhou Manqiwei units, with operating pressure adjustable on-site. Low-temperature models incorporate additional Sagami condensing pressure controllers to enable fan speed regulation.
